Keeping your pool's chemical balance in check is vital for swimmer safety and pool health. Correct chemical levels stop algae and bacteria growth, ensure clear water and protect pool surfaces and equipment.
- Maintaining Proper pH: The pH balance in your pool is a measure of its acidity or alkalinity. A balanced pH level should be between 7.2 and 7.6. Low pH levels result in acidic water, causing skin irritation and equipment corrosion. Alkaline water from high pH causes cloudiness and scaling. Frequent pH testing and adjustments is vital for swimmer comfort and safety.
- Managing Chlorine Concentration: Chlorine plays a crucial role in pool sanitation, killing bacteria, algae, and other harmful microorganisms. The proper chlorine level is between 1-3 ppm. Low chlorine levels cause unsanitary water, with bacteria and algae proliferating. Too much chlorine can cause skin and eye irritation and produce a strong chlorine odor. Regularly testing and adjusting chlorine levels ensures effective sanitation and swimmer comfort.
Managing Total AlkalinityTotal alkalinity is a crucial element of pool chemistry. Alkalinity stabilizes pH levels, helping to prevent drastic changes in pH. Proper total alkalinity levels range from 80 to 120 ppm.
- Preventing pH Swings: Correct alkalinity levels ensure stable pH, preventing rapid changes that can cause skin irritation and damage to pool surfaces. If alkalinity is too low, pH levels can fluctuate wildly, making consistent balance difficult. High alkalinity causes cloudy water and scaling. Consistently monitoring and adjusting alkalinity levels is essential for maintaining a stable and balanced pool.
- Calcium Hardness Control: Calcium hardness indicates the calcium level in pool water. Proper calcium hardness levels range from 200 to 400 ppm. If calcium levels are too low, the water becomes corrosive, damaging pool surfaces and equipment. High calcium levels lead to scaling and cloudy water. Consistently monitoring and adjusting calcium hardness is important for protecting your pool and ensuring clear water.
Safe Handling of Pool ChemicalsHandling and storing pool chemicals properly is vital for safety and chemical performance. Chemicals should be stored in a cool, dry place, away from sunlight, children, and pets. Follow the manufacturer's instructions for dosing and application.
- Measuring and Mixing Chemicals: Accurately measuring pool chemicals is essential to maintain the proper balance. Inaccurate dosing can disrupt the chemical balance and affect water quality. Always use a clean, dry measuring tool and avoid mixing chemicals directly. Mix chemicals in water if required, following the instructions carefully.
- Chemical Reaction Awareness: Certain chemicals can react dangerously if mixed. Never mix chlorine with acid, for example. Knowing these interactions helps prevent accidents and ensures safe handling. Keep chemicals separate and handle with caution to avoid harmful reactions.
